Dibutyl Phthalate (Glow Stick) Ingestion In Dogs: Symptoms, Causes, _ Treatments

Dibutyl phthalate ingestion in dogs is the technical term for what happens when a dog manages to eat some of the chemicals found inside glow sticks and glow jewelry. It’s more common around holidays and special events when they might have access to glow sticks and glow accessories that humans use to celebrate.
